Transaction 55313d626eceb81b8b3653202a9280a87d06310d81aa6bf622827c9bb23f6586
1 Input
1 Output
-
55313d626eceb81b8b3653202a9280a87d06310d81aa6bf622827c9bb23f6586:0
- value
- 26186
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5cfbedab6456cd1925e1850d17c026061ef74a0 OP_EQUAL
- address
- 3MBYipGRicvg4WQsMaGSLu1qFwyffRznv5